TURN-208: Gatevale turnstile counters at the Merrow Field pilot double-count when a rotation reverses mid-cycle. Attendance totals drift roughly 2% high per event. The debounce window fix is implemented, reviewed by Ilsa, and soak-tested across two simulated match days without drift. Ready for your cut; the candidate build is identified below.

trace token, tagag-tafog: htk6_5ed18c

## Account Recovery — Trailnote Offline Mode

When a surveyor's Trailnote app has been offline for 30+ days, their local credentials expire and sync refuses to resume. Don't make them wipe the device — all their unsynced field data lives there! Instead, open the support console, pick "Offline Reinstate," and enter their handle. The console will ask for the support team's shared recovery passphrase before issuing a reinstatement token. Use the one below.

unlock words, bagaf-fajeg: zorael-kelax-fraath-quenix-eliok-sileth-aldmir-wenir-druiel

Q2 Planning Note — Branch Leases

Quick heads-up, folks: we're renegotiating the master lease covering the Northvale and Perrow branches. Rents there have drifted well above market, and our landlord seems open to a blended-rate deal. Expect some noise about floor space consolidation over the summer. The thinking behind this is captured below.

confidential, kagup-bafog: Fraaxax Group is in early talks to buy Soroxox Group for about $343.8 million. The Olidor launch date is June 14, and nothing goes to the press before then. Legal wants the Aldmirek Logistics term sheet signed before July 23.

Subject: Pedalshift rebalancer — v2.4 is out the door

Hey release channel,

Pedalshift 2.4 just shipped. This is the release that finally teaches the rebalancing planner about hill penalties, so trucks in the Bramford zone stop getting routed up Copperhill for two bikes. Future maintainers: the solver config moved into the planner module, so old overrides are ignored — check the migration notes. For reproducibility, this release was cut from the build stamped below.

trace token, fafog-kageg: htk4_98e6